America’s biggest sporting event of the year, Super Bowl LIV, featured a former Hinds Eagle Football Standout, Charvarius Ward (McComb). Ward is in his second season in the NFL and is currently the starting cornerback for the Kansas City Chiefs. Ward has tallied 74 tackles, two interceptions, one forced fumble, and 10 passes defended this…

In 2015, Mississippi College’s table tennis team captured the national championship. Led by stars from China, including Cheng Li and Yichi Zhang, the Choctaws edged perennial champ Texas Wesleyan University in Wisconsin.
